Central South University (CSU) in China offers non-Chinese students the opportunity to apply for undergraduate and postgraduate scholarships in various fields of study for the academic year 2018-2019. Applicants are required to have a strong academic background and a great capability of research, and must not be funded by any other scholarships. For English-taught programs, TOEFL 85 or IELTS 6.0 received within two years is required, unless the applicant is a native speaker of English or the previous degree was fully taught in it. For Chinese-taught programs, HSK 4 (above 180) is required, unless the applicant is a native speaker of Chinese or the previous degree was fully taught in it. Applicants who are not qualified for HSK when applying must attend Chinese training for one year in CSU and pass the test. The bachelor’s degree lasts for 4-5 years, the master’s degree for 3 years, and the PhD for 4 years.
Fully-funded scholarships cover tuition fees, on-campus accommodation and medical insurance fees. This is in addition to providing a monthly stipend of 2000 RMB for bachelor’s degree students, 2500 RMB for master’s degree students and 3000 RMB for PhD students. Partial scholarships cover tuition and medical insurance fees.
